VANCOUVER CANADA – Walking Tour – Travel guide

Vancouver is a City in Western Canada , located in the Lower Mainland of the province of Colombia -British . As the most populous city in the province, its population stands at 662,248 and its agglomeration at 2.6 million in 2021 , making it theeighth largest city and third largest metropolitan area in Canada. Vancouver has the highest population density in the entire country, with over 5,400 people per square kilometer.

It is one of the most ethno-racially and linguistically diverse cities in Canada: 52% of its residents are not native English speakers , 48.9% are native speakers of neither English nor French , and 50.6% of residents belong to visible minority groups . Vancouver is considered one of the most livable cities in Canada and in the world. However, it remains one of the most expensive cities in the world, particularly in terms of access to housing . City Council plans to make Vancouver the greenest city in the world. ” Vancouverism ” corresponds to this philosophy of urban planningfrom the city.

The town was originally named Gastown , and grew around a sawmill called Hastings Mills , built on July 1 , 1867, by sailor John Deighton . Gastown is then officially registered as a townsite called Granville. The site was renamed “Vancouver” and incorporated as a city in 1886 , through an agreement with the Canadian Pacific Railway Company . The following year, the transcontinental railroad was extended to the city. The city’s large natural seaport on the Pacific Ocean became a vital link in trade between the Far East , Europe and Eastern Canada .

Vancouver has hosted many international conferences and events, such as the 1954 British Empire and Commonwealth Games , the 1976 UN Habitat I conference , the 1986 Specialized Exhibition , the APEC summit in 1997 , the World Police and Fire Games in 1989 and 2009 , several games of the 2015 FIFA Women’s World Cup including the final at BC Place Stadium , the 2010 Winter Olympics and Paralympics and theInternational Ornithological Congress in 2018 . In 1969 Greenpeace was founded in Vancouver . The city became the permanent home of TED conferences in 2014
